Boundary changes

This unit was affected by the following changes:

Date Type of change Other unit involved Area transferred Authority
01 Apr 1932 was enlarged by the abolition of GUISBOROUGH RD the CPs of Commondale, Danby, & Westerdale, & part of Easington CP Area: 25334 acres. Population in 1931: 1565.   1931 Census of England and Wales, Table B, 'Areas altered between 26th April, 1931 and 30th June, 1934, showing constitution as at the latter date, in terms of constitution as at the former date, together with particulars of acreage and population'.; M. of H. Order No. 76122. The North Riding of Yorkshire (Northern Areas) Order, 1932
01 Apr 1932 was enlarged by the abolition of HINDERWELL UD Area: 1659 acres. Population in 1931: 2146.   1931 Census of England and Wales, Table B, 'Areas altered between 26th April, 1931 and 30th June, 1934, showing constitution as at the latter date, in terms of constitution as at the former date, together with particulars of acreage and population'.; M. of H. Order No. 76122. The North Riding of Yorkshire (Northern Areas) Order, 1932
01 Apr 1932 was reduced to enlarge WHITBY UD parts of the CPs of Aislaby, & Hawsker with Stainsacre Area: 643 acres. Population in 1931: 229.   1931 Census of England and Wales, Table B, 'Areas altered between 26th April, 1931 and 30th June, 1934, showing constitution as at the latter date, in terms of constitution as at the former date, together with particulars of acreage and population'.; M. of H. Order No. 76122. The North Riding of Yorkshire (Northern Areas) Order, 1932
